Objet : Supervision des services auto-service sur VM Windows avec Centreon /SNMP

Bonjour,

J'ai besoin de votre aide pour superviser tous les services auto-service sur des VMs Windows.

Le problème est que les plugins Centreon par défaut utilisent des commandes WMI (pas d’installation de client centreon sur les machines), ce qui n'est pas adapté à mon besoin car mon équipe souhaite utiliser uniquement les services SNMP.

J'ai essayé de créer un nouveau service avec la commande suivante :

 

/usr/lib/centreon/plugins/centreon_windows_snmp.pl --plugin=os::windows::snmp::plugin --mode=service --hostname=$HOSTADDRESS$ --snmp-version='$_HOSTSNMPVERSION$' --snmp-community='$_HOSTSNMPCOMMUNITY$' --service='' --state='paused|stopped' --regexp

 

Cependant, je n'arrive pas à obtenir les résultats souhaités et à être alerté uniquement lorsqu'un service auto-service passe en état arrêté ou en pause.

Pourriez-vous m'aider à configurer la supervision des services auto-service sur des VM Windows en utilisant uniquement le SNMP ()?

SNMP is deprecated on windows since Windows 2012 Features Removed or Deprecated in Windows Server 2012 | Microsoft Learn

you will get problem to get the services as if a service is not running it will disapear from the snmp table unless someone refresh the local service console, it is a bug from microsoft and it will never be corrected as they said as they stopped developping snmp.

it still work a bit, for cpu, ram, network, processes, but services are a bit special and it doesnt work like with nsclient or wmi, it cannot list “automatic” services, it list only the started services, not the “not running” ones, and it takes times (or a manipulation like starting/stopping a service) for the snmp table to get updated

WSMan is a native windows agent for monitoring, it is the only “agentless” alternative

Centreon is working on an alternative to nsclient with a centreon agent (for next year ? i’m waiting for it)

but there are no clean alternative today, no agents, no data
